‘Everything’s Gonna Be Okay’ Cast Will Host Panel For Autism Acceptance Month

Share

In celebration of Autism Acceptance Month, the cast behind Everything’s Gonna Be Okay will participate in a panel with the Autism Society of America. Kayla Cromer, Lillian Carrier, Maeve Press, Adam Faison, and Josh Thomas (who also created the series) will appear at the event, which will take place on Facebook Live on April 2.

Everything’s Gonna Be Okay has been praised for its representation of autism through the lead character of Matilda (Cromer) as well as supporting characters like Drea (Carrier) and Jeremy (Carsen Warner). Carrier also serves as the show’s autism consultant, and the creators behind the show are committed to casting authentically.

Everything’s Gonna Be Okay will return for its second season on April 8 on Freeform with back-to-back episodes. You can watch the panel here, and check out the trailer for season 2 here.
